Travelling on transit on the weekends just got easier.
Starting on May 14, 2022 and every weekend and holiday until September 4, 2022, all family passes and day passes are $3. A day pass is available for one person and a family pass is for up to 2 adults and 3 children. These passes are available on the bus or on the Transit App. Try Transit this weekend!

Changes in Port Weller East and West St. Catharines Trans Cab Service
St. Catharines Transit is excited to announce a new service to replace existing TransCab services. St. Catharines Transit On Demand is a new service that will pick up passengers in the current TransCab areas and drop them off at a bus stop close to their destination or to transfer into the fixed route network. The Niagara Regional Council passed a temporary face covering by-law which requires face coverings in enclosed public spaces, and on regional and municipal transit during the COVID-19 pandemic. This by-law is to help reduce the spread of COVID-19 in indoor public spaces as more businesses and services being to reopen.
With the by-law, the Niagara Region has made the wearing of masks on public transit mandatory. St Catharines Transit is reminding its riders, and those visiting its facilities, to wear a mask or face covering. Masks must be worn before entering buses, terminals, Paratransit buses and contracted taxis. Click here for additional resources.

Get the Transit App
We are pleased to introduce the Transit App. This app will allow users to know in real-time when their bus will arrive at the stop they are waiting at. Users can plan a trip with the trip planner or follow the bus along on the map. There are links to our website that will allow users to know of detours and other important information. And, if you’re looking to purchase your ride card, 31-day pass or Day Pass on your smartphone, St Catharines Transit also offers Mobile Ticketing on the Transit app.

Download the app from the App Store on your iPhone, or from the Google Play Store on Android to your smartphone. Then create an account and you can purchase your 31-Day Pass, 10 Ride card, One Ride or Day Pass on your phone. It is that easy.
Once you have purchased your product, activate it just before getting on your bus and show the active ticket to the Bus Operator.
Should your have an issue with your app purchase you can use the feedback option within the app. Always ensure that you are logged into the app before sending a feedback request.
